Gpu issue in tot chrome which stops chrome from starting up.

Project Member Reported by xiaoyinh@chromium.org, Feb 8 2018

Issue description

Error message from ui/ui.LATEST:
[4195:4201:0208/132255.669620:ERROR:gbm_buffer.cc(87)] handles: 2, stride: 9728, offset: 0, modifier: 0
[4195:4201:0208/132255.670789:ERROR:gbm_buffer.cc(81)] AddFramebuffer2 failed: : Invalid argument (22)
[4195:4201:0208/132255.670922:ERROR:gbm_buffer.cc(82)] planes: 1, width: 2400, height: 1600, addfb_flags

I'm going to revert the culprit CL:  https://chromium-review.googlesource.com/c/chromium/src/+/907756

 
Cc: -hoegsberg@chromium.org
Owner: hoegsberg@chromium.org
reverted. 
hoegsberg@, could you take a look at this? Thanks!
This CL requires this CL in minigbm in chromeos:

https://chromium-review.googlesource.com/c/chromiumos/platform/minigbm/+/907848

which has already landed on master. Where you running a newer chrome on an older chromeos rootfs?
Re#2: Do you know which version of chrome os should have your CL? I might be using an older version. Feel free to re-land if this is been resolved.
It landed in ChromeOS 10385.0.0, which finished building 10 minutes after you filed the bug :)

I'll reland a little later today after it's cooled down a bit.
